The 2025 Honda Civic Type R continues to represent the pinnacle of Honda’s high-performance capabilities, returning with minimal changes but commanding presence. At its heart lies a turbocharged 2.0-liter VTEC four-cylinder engine that churns out 315 horsepower and 310 lb-ft of torque, making it one of the most potent front-wheel-drive vehicles available today.
Every Type R utilizes a six-speed manual transmission, a limited-slip differential, and front-wheel drive. The rev-matching feature ensures smooth downshifts, while the Civic Type R-exclusive shift link mechanism makes shifting even smoother.
Performance Specifications Table
Specification | 2025 Honda Civic Type R |
---|---|
Engine | 2.0L Turbocharged 4-cylinder |
Horsepower | 315 hp @ 6,500 rpm |
Torque | 310 lb-ft @ 2,600-4,000 rpm |
Transmission | 6-speed Manual |
0-60 mph | 5.3 seconds |
Quarter Mile | 13.9 seconds @ 104.2 mph |
Top Speed | 180 mph (estimated) |
Advanced Engineering and Handling
Honda builds the Civic Type R for handling and cornering more than outright acceleration, which is why it set the FWD record at the legendary Nürburgring racetrack. The unique dual-axis MacPherson strut front suspension helps minimize torque steer and deliver precise steering response.
Driving Modes and Customization
The adaptive dampers can be configured through Comfort, Sport, and +R settings, with Individual mode allowing 486 total combinations of settings for maximum customization.
Aerodynamic Enhancements
A 48% larger grille opening than the previous-generation Civic Type R and optimized brake ducts help keep components cooler during track sessions.
Safety Features and Technology
While the Civic Type R hasn’t been rated by NHTSA or IIHS, all models come equipped with Honda Sensing suite including lane keeping, automatic emergency braking, cross-traffic and blind-spot monitoring, and adaptive cruise control. Additional safety technology includes traffic sign recognition and driver focus monitoring. For comprehensive safety ratings, visit the NHTSA website.
Interior and Technology Features
All versions feature a 10.2-inch digital instrument cluster, 9.0-inch infotainment touchscreen, w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, plus a wireless phone charging pad. The cabin includes premium touches like a Bose sound system and heavily bolstered red front seats upholstered with synthetic suede.
Fuel Economy and Pricing
Efficiency and Value Table
Category | 2025 Civic Type R |
---|---|
City MPG | 22 mpg |
Highway MPG | 28 mpg |
Combined MPG | 24 mpg |
Starting MSRP | $47,045 |
Cargo Space | 24.5 cubic feet |
For 2025, EPA-rated fuel economy measures 22/28 mpg city/highway. The price starts at $47,045, representing an $800 increase from the previous year. For current EPA efficiency ratings, check the EPA’s official website.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What’s new for the 2025 Honda Civic Type R?
A: The 2025 model returns unchanged mechanically, with only a price increase of $800.
Q: How does the Type R compare to competitors?
A: It competes directly with the Toyota GR Corolla and VW Golf R, all approaching the $50,000 mark.
Q: Is the Type R suitable for daily driving?
A: The car’s personality transitions from basic commuter to slick canyon carver with seamless confidence.
